Pretty In Pink(1986)
Brat Pack 80s actress Molly Ringwald plays a poor girl with offbeat style who falls for a rich kid, while others frown on the social divide.

I have to admit I do love this film. I adore this film a lot more than I should. I really had to give a review for this film. Pretty In Pink got their casting spot on and I am so chuffed about it; it wouldn’t have been so great if it had a different cast, or if they didn’t have the fabulous Molly Ringwald whom played the main character, Andie Walsh. I really, truly do love this film, it has a brilliant balance of romance and humour, but it still manages to give us a couple of life lessons and show us a couple of things, like how even back then people cared about where you’re from, how popular you are and how much money you have. Whilst watching the movie I do wonder if maybe they cared about that type of stuff even more than we do... Hmm. Now this film did do an amazing job of making me fall in love with a certain character, Duckie Dale. He was just perfect, brilliantly played and made me just want to hug him. Jon Cryer did an amazing job with the character and despite how much I adore Robert Downey Jr (who very nearly played Duckie) I couldn’t imagine there being a better actor to play Duckie if I tried. I really hope more people watch this film and I really hope people enjoy this film just as much as I do.
